Swamp Thing | Author: Scott Snyder | 2012 | Site I had wanted to try out a few of DC’s new 52 comics but I have never been a huge super hero comic book fan. When I saw Scott Snyder (American Vampire, Severed) was writing Swamp Thing I knew I had to give it a try. I am hooked now and can’t help but get excited every other Wednesday when it comes out. Snyder’s Swamp Thing delves into the history of the “Swamp Things”. To the point it begins with the elders expecting protagonist, Alec Holland, to be the savior of the Green. This story is a fight of balance and love. The rot is what Swamp Thing is fighting and trying to keep from taking over the world. Snyder’s writing never ceases to draw me in. Swamp Thing is fantastic and I think giving it a try Snyder will get you hooked like me. Publisher: DC | # in Series: Ongoing Swamp Thing #1 Cover

The Elder Scrolls V: Skyrim | RPG, First Person, Adventure | 2011 | Site Skyrim is a fantasy, first and third person open world, RPG that allows and encourages you to do almost anything. The civil war plot and dragon resurrection storyline are very meticulous and fulfilling to complete. The overarching story is great but you will get lost in wondering around, leveling skills, talking to people and taking up side quests. Some of the most fun you can have with Skyrim is talking to someone else that has played it and comparing stories. It is amazing how different your story can be. My girlfriend and I started playing at the exact same minute and once gameplay started it took about 10 minutes before we started encountering different people, places and things to do. I can’t say enough good things about Bethesda; they have created a work of art. Skyrim is one of the best games in the past ten years and, in my opinion of all time. Melancholia | 2011 | Director: Lars von Trier | Site | IMDB Melancholia is a planet newly entered into Earth’s orbit, threatening to collide and destroy it. More so it is the story of two sisters and their strained relationship. Melancholia is my choice for best film of 2011. Beautiful, dark, romantic and perfect really… It would be hard to pick a more cinematically beautiful film. The first few minutes are the most beautiful and moving in any film I have seen in recent years. The score is matched with precision. It is beautiful, creepy and emotional.

Audition | 1999 | Director: Takashi Miike | IMDB How can you not love this movie? It is a modern horror classic with a huge payoff ending for horror lovers. This is one of my favorite Miike movies of all time. A nice slow burn of a film leading you in one direction then a perfect gore filled, life-changing ending.
